ATHOS SILICON CHIEF mSoC™ ARCHITECT FRANCOIS PIEDNOEL TO PRESENT THE IEEE WORLD TECHNOLOGY SUMMIT 2025 IN BERLIN

SANTA CLARA, CA — Francois Piednoel, Athos Silicon CTO and Chief mSoC™ Architect, will present Design of Safe Chiplet Systems for Modern Autonomy at the IEEE World Technology Summit 2025 in Berlin on September 8, 2025.

Francois will detail how Athos Silicon's Multiple Systems on Chip (mSoC™) unified control fabric integrates power management, deterministic scheduling, and hardware voting, dynamically orchestrating redundant cores for fail-operational autonomy. This approach removes single points of failure, delivers real-time deterministic execution, and simplifies certification across robotics, autonomy, and aerospace.

The IEEE World Technology Summit is a strategic initiative of the IEEE Industry Engagement Committee, designed to strengthen collaboration between IEEE and global industry. The program focuses on supporting design and development processes by addressing real-world challenges, shaping product requirements, and proposing standards and strategies that lead to successful, cooperative implementations.

About Athos Silicon

Athos Silicon builds safety-critical AI compute for the physical world. Its Multiple Systems on Chip (mSoC™) architecture is built around Chiptile™, a foundational compute chiplet, enabling in-package tiling to deliver deterministic autonomy across robotics, automotive, and aerospace. With Chiptile, scaling is replication, not reintegration, expanding capability without multiplying system complexity.
